## Workflow
|
||
|
||
### Setup Local
|
||
|
||
```bash
|
||
cd ESP32_ZACUS
|
||
python3 -m venv .venv
|
||
source .venv/bin/activate
|
||
pip install platformio esptool pyserial
|
||
|
||
# List PlatformIO boards
|
||
pio boards | grep freenove
|
||
```
|
||
|
||
### Build & Upload Freenove (firmware + LittleFS)
|
||
|
||
```bash
|
||
pio run -e freenove_esp32s3_full_with_ui
|
||
pio run -e freenove_esp32s3_full_with_ui -t buildfs
|
||
pio run -e freenove_esp32s3_full_with_ui -t uploadfs --upload-port /dev/cu.usbmodem5AB90753301
|
||
pio run -e freenove_esp32s3_full_with_ui -t upload --upload-port /dev/cu.usbmodem5AB90753301
|
||
```
|
||
|
||
### Serial Monitor (115200 baud)
|
||
|
||
```bash
|
||
pio device monitor -p /dev/cu.usbmodem5AB90753301 -b 115200
|
||
```
